Historical & Cultural Background
Laquisha is a name that emerged in the United States, particularly within African American communities, during the late 20th century. It is often seen as a modern variation of names like Lakeisha, which itself has roots in the name Keisha. The prefix 'La-' is a common feature in many African American names, reflecting a trend of unique and creative naming practices. Names like Laquisha often carry personal and cultural significance for families.

U.S. Historical Usage
The name Laquisha was first seen in the United States in 1969. Laquisha has ranked as high as #1051 nationally, which occurred in 1991, and has been most popular in Texas, California, Florida, North Carolina, and Georgia. In the past 5 years the name Laquisha has been trending down compared to the previous 5 years.

Popularity Over Time (National) — Table
Year | Births |
---|---|
1969 | 8 |
1970 | 6 |
1971 | 12 |
1972 | 31 |
1973 | 31 |
1974 | 55 |
1975 | 46 |
1976 | 68 |
1977 | 83 |
1978 | 64 |
1979 | 102 |
1980 | 111 |
1981 | 103 |
1982 | 99 |
1983 | 102 |
1984 | 131 |
1985 | 103 |
1986 | 110 |
1987 | 129 |
1988 | 126 |
1989 | 139 |
1990 | 144 |
1991 | 176 |
1992 | 161 |
1993 | 121 |
1994 | 108 |
1995 | 72 |
1996 | 63 |
1997 | 68 |
1998 | 34 |
1999 | 28 |
2000 | 31 |
2001 | 27 |
2002 | 6 |
2003 | 11 |
2004 | 8 |
2006 | 6 |
2011 | 5 |
